app / io.geeteshk.dot.utils

Package io.geeteshk.dot.utils

Types

Constants

class Constants

Constant values that are used throughout the app

Flashlight

class Flashlight

Utility class to control device Flashlight

Spanner

class Spanner

Utility class for managing spans on displayed text

Extensions for External Classes

android.text.Editable

android.view.View

android.widget.EditText

com.google.android.material.floatingactionbutton.FloatingActionButton

com.google.android.material.textfield.TextInputEditText

kotlin.String

Functions

delay

fun delay(period: Int): Unit

Utility function to make sleeping threads look cleaner

showRationale

fun showRationale(result: PermissionResult, activity: AppCompatActivity, layout: View): Unit

Display rationales to the user if something goes wrong when asking for permissions